Community Spotlight: Herrin CUSD #4
What services do you provide?
We provide Pre-K through 12th grade education across four schools, along with special education, vocational training, and early childhood programs through county cooperatives. We also offer adult education classes in partnership with John A. Logan College, food service programs, technology support, and curriculum guidance. In addition, the Herrin Education Foundation supports our students through scholarships and classroom resources.
How have you seen the organization make a difference?
We have seen measurable academic growth, such as improved literacy scores in early grades. Our graduation rate is above the state average, and our community outreach programs have earned statewide recognition. Through scholarships and classroom investments, we have also helped students pursue higher education and enriched learning opportunities..
Herrin CUSD #4 serves approximately 2,300 students across five educational facilities, ranging from PreK through grade 12: Herrin PreK Center, Northside Primary Center, Herrin Elementary School, Herrin Junior High School, and Herrin High School. Our district provides premier public education to the City of Herrin and surrounding communities. Herrin is a historic city in Williamson County, known for its coal-mining heritage and strong community spirit. Nestled amongst Crab Orchard National Wildlife Refuge, Shawnee National Forest, Shawnee Hills Wine Trail, and numerous historical sights, our area offers endless opportunities for outdoor recreation, culture, and relaxation.
